    Background

    This gene encodes a C3H-type zinc finger protein, which is similar to the Drosophila melanogaster muscleblind B protein. Drosophila muscleblind is a gene required for photoreceptor differentiation. Several alternatively spliced transcript variants have been described but the full-length natures of only some have been determined.Synonyms: MBLL, MBLL39, MLP1, Muscleblind-like protein 1, Muscleblind-like protein 2, Muscleblind-like protein-like, Muscleblind-like protein-like 39
